Beyond Monotherapy: The Evolving Role of CTLA-4 in Combination Immunotherapy for Gastrointestinal Cancers.

Cytotoxic T-lymphocyte-associated protein 4 (CTLA-4) is a key immune checkpoint in Gastrointestinal system cancers (GSCs), inhibiting T-cell activation by outcompeting CD28 for B7-1/B7-2 binding on antigen-presenting cells, thereby promoting immune evasion. Its overexpression correlates with advanced stage, poor survival, and worse prognosis in gastric, colorectal, esophageal, and pancreatic cancers. CTLA-4 blockade with Ipilimumab or Tremelimumab shows promise, especially combined with PD-1/PD-L1 inhibitors, yielding enhanced antitumor immunity in microsatellite instability-high/deficient mismatch repair (MSI-H/dMMR) tumors with high immune infiltration. However, efficacy is limited by tumor heterogeneity and an immunosuppressive microenvironment enriched in CTLA-4⁺ regulatory T cells (Tregs). Inconsistent clinical responses underscore the need for predictive biomarkers, optimized combinations, and mechanistic insights into resistance. This review explores CTLA-4's role in GSCs, highlighting microenvironment-focused strategies to improve precision and therapeutic outcomes.

Logic-Gated Dual-Aptamer Proximity AlphaLISA for Rapid and Sensitive Detection of Tumor-Derived Small Extracellular Vesicles.

This programmable dual-aptamer amplified luminescent proximity homogeneous assay (AlphaLISA) provides a rapid, homogeneous, and highly adaptable strategy for tumor-derived sEVs analysis, offering promising potential for noninvasive cancer diagnostics.
